Mt. Everest Tour from Lhasa

Noted as the highest peak above the sea level, Mt. Everest keeps attracting numerous tourists all around the world. A large number of tourists would like to start a Mt. Everest tour from Lhasa after they land on Tibet Plateau.

Mt. Everest Tour from Lhasa – Attractions

Tourists planning a Mt. Everest tour could not only enjoy the cultural highlights in Lhasa City but also enjoy the historical sites and natural scenic spots along the way to Mt. Everest.

The ancient Palkhor Monastery in Gyantse County was constructed in early 15th century – the common development period of Sakya, Gelug and Gedang sects of Tibetan Buddhism. Hence, it has special status and influence in the history of Tibetan Buddhism. Tourists make a Mt. Everest tour could appreciate the exquisite murals and Buddhism statues in the monastery on the way to Mt. Everest.

Tourists planning a Mt. Everest tour could also enjoy the amazing Karo-la Glacier on the way to Mt. Everest. Karo-la Glacier is one of the three giant mainland glaciers in Tibet. A large number of tourists would get off the vehicle to enjoy the miracle created by the nature. The giant glacier looks like a Thangka stretching out from the top of the mountain

Mt. Everest Tour from Lhasa – Tent and Sleeping Bag

Before start the Mt. Everest tour from Lhasa, tourists are advised to make a good preparation. To ensure a comfortable rest at Mt. Everest Base Camp, tourists should prepare a tent and sleeping bag. The tent renting service is available in Lhasa.

When it comes to the sleeping bag, it is really one of the most important necessities for a Mt. Everest tour. It should be noted that the accommodation condition in the guesthouse is pretty limited; a sleeping bag would keep you warmer during the night, especially for tourists planning to camp at the Mt. Everest Base Camp.
